Driving 65 mph, it takes Alicia 3 hours to reach the airport to go on a vacation. It then takes her 4 hours to get to her destin
ation with the jet traveling at a speed of 450 mph. How many miles does Alicia travel to get to her destination?
2 answers:
Answer:
1,955 miles
Step-by-step explanation:
For this problem all we have to do is, assuming they were constantly going that speed and never stopped, multiply the items and the mph.
SO, to the airport is 65mph*3 hours, which would give 195 miles.
Then, To their destination, 450mph * 4hours = 1,800 miles
Now all that is left to do is add
195 + 1,800 = 1,995
1,995 miles
